Въведение в употребите на C ++

C ++ е език за програмиране, който има императивни и обектно-ориентирани функции. Нарича се също и като език за програмиране от средно ниво. Той е разработен от Bjarne Stroustrup в Bell Labs от 1979 г. За пръв път се появява през 1985 г. Той е компилиран, с общо предназначение, статичен тип, чувствителен към регистъра и език за свободна форма. Той поддържа процедурно, обектно-ориентирано и общо програмиране. Това е богата стандартна библиотека с богат набор от функции, манипулиращи файлове и методи, манипулиращи структури от данни и т.н.

C ++ се използва широко сред програмистите или разработчиците главно в областта на приложението. Той съдържа важните части, включително основния език, осигуряващ всички необходими градивни елементи, включително променливи, типове данни, литерали и др. Той поддържа обектно-ориентирано програмиране, включително неговите функции като Наследяване, Полиморфизъм, Капсулация и Абстракция. Тези концепции правят езика на C ++ различен и най-вече се използва за разработването на приложенията лесно и концептуализирани.

Използване на C ++

Има няколко предимства от използването на C ++ за разработване на приложения и много приложения, базирани на продукта, разработени на този език само поради неговите функции и сигурност. Моля, намерете по-долу раздели, където използването на C ++ е широко и ефективно използвано. По-долу е списъкът с 10-те най-добри употреби на C ++.

  • Приложения: Използва се за разработване на нови приложения на C ++. Приложенията, базирани на графичния потребителски интерфейс, които са изключително използвани приложения като Adobe Photoshop и други. Много приложения на Adobe системи са разработени в C ++ като Illustrator, Adobe Premiere и готови изображения и разработчиците на Adobe се считат за активни в C ++ общността.
  • Игри: Този език се използва и за разработване на игри. Той отменя сложността на 3D игрите. Помага при оптимизиране на ресурсите. Той поддържа опцията за мултиплейър с мрежа. Използването на C ++ позволява процедурно програмиране за интензивни функции на процесора и осигуряване на контрол върху хардуера, като този език е много бърз, поради което е широко използван при разработването на различни игри или в игрални двигатели. C ++, използван главно при разработването на пакети на игрален инструмент.
  • Анимация: Има анимиран софтуер, който е разработен с помощта на езика C ++. 3D софтуерът за анимация, моделиране, симулация, изобразяване се обозначава като мощен набор от инструменти. Той е широко използван за изграждане в реално време, за обработка на изображения, мобилни сензорни приложения и визуални ефекти, моделиране, което се кодира основно в C ++. Този разработен софтуер, използван за анимация, среда, графики за движение, виртуална реалност и създаване на герои. Виртуалните реални устройства са най-популярните в днешния свят на забавленията.
  • Уеб браузър: Този език се използва и за разработване на браузъри. C ++ се използва за създаване на Google Chrome и Mozilla Internet браузър Firefox. Някои от приложенията са написани на C ++, от които браузърът Chrome е едно от тях, а други са като файлова система, картата намалява обработката на големи данни от клъстери. Mozilla има и друго приложение, написано също на C ++, което е имейл клиент Mozilla Thunderbird. C ++ също е двигател за изобразяване на проекти с отворен код на Google и Mozilla.
  • Достъп до база данни: Този език се използва и за разработване на софтуер за база данни или софтуер с база данни с отворен код. Примерът за това е MySQL, който е един от най-популярните софтуер за управление на бази данни и широко използван в организации или сред разработчиците. Той помага за спестяване на време, пари, бизнес системи и пакетиран софтуер. Има и други приложения, базирани на софтуер за достъп до база данни, които са Wikipedia, Yahoo, youtube и др. Другият пример е Bloomberg RDBMS, който помага при предоставянето на финансова информация в реално време на инвеститорите. Написано е главно на C ++, което прави достъпа до база данни бърз и бърз или точен за предоставяне на информация относно бизнеса и финансите, новини по целия свят.
  • Достъп до медия: C ++ се използва и за създаване на медиен плейър, управление на видео файлове и аудио файлове. Примерът е Winamp Media Player, който е разработен на език C ++, който ни позволява да се наслаждаваме на музика, достъп и споделяне на видеоклипове и музикални файлове. Освен това има функции като поддръжка на изкуство, стрийминг на аудио и видео. Той също така осигурява достъп до интернет радиостанции.
  • Съставители: Повечето компилатори са написани главно само на език C ++. Компилаторите, които се използват за компилиране на други езици като C #, Java и др., Главно написани само на C ++. Използва се и при разработването на тези езици, както и C ++ е независим от платформата и може да създава разнообразен софтуер.
  • Операционни системи: Използва се и за разработване на повечето операционни системи за Microsoft и няколко части от операционната система Apple. Microsoft Windows 95, 98, 2000, XP, офис, Internet Explorer и визуално студио, мобилните операционни системи Symbian се изписват главно само на език C ++.
  • Сканиране: Приложенията като филмов скенер или скенер за камера също са разработени на езика C ++. Той е използван за разработване на PDF технология за печат на документация, обмен на документи, архивиране на документа и публикуване на документите.
  • Други приложения: използва се за медицински и инженерни приложения, компютърно проектирани системи. Тези приложения са като машини за ЯМР сканиране, CAM системи, които се използват главно в болници, местни, държавни и национални правителства и други отдели за строителство и минни работи и др. производителността се счита за всяко развиващо се приложение.

Заключение - Използване на C ++

C ++ е езикът, който се използва навсякъде, но главно в системите за програмиране и вградените системи. Тук системното програмиране означава разработване на операционни системи или драйвери, които взаимодействат с хардуер. Вградена система означава неща, които са автомобили, роботика и уреди. C ++ има по-висока или богата общност и разработчици, което помага за лесното наемане на програмисти и онлайн решения лесно.

Използването на C ++ е посочено като най-безопасния език поради неговата сигурност и функции. Това е първият език за всеки разработчик, който се интересува от работа в езици за програмиране. Учи се лесно, тъй като е чист език, основан на концепция. Неговият синтаксис е много прост, което улеснява писането или развитието и грешките могат лесно да се репликират. Преди да използват който и да е друг език, програмистите предпочитат първо да научат C ++ и след това да използват други езици. Но повечето от разработчиците се опитват да се придържат към C ++ само поради голямото му разнообразие от използване и съвместимост с множество платформи и софтуер.

Препоръчани статии:

Това е ръководство за използване на C ++ в реалния свят. Тук сме обсъдили различните употреби на C ++ като игри, анимация, уеб браузъри и др. Можете също да разгледате следната статия, за да научите повече -

  1. Топ 10 употреби на Ruby, които трябва да знаете в реалния живот
  2. Използване на Дженкинс
  3. Топ 10 употреби на кодиране в ежедневния живот
  4. Използване на Python
  5. СУБД срещу RDBMS: Сравнение